Elena Eneva has 20+ years of experience in AI, ML, and data science across R&D, technical, and business groups. - Experienced in building and mentoring interdisciplinary R&D, product development, and consulting teams across academia and industry.- Proven track record in collaboration with government agencies and nonprofits.- Expert in leading, developing, and delivering complex analytics strategy and novel AI solutions for healthcare, Internet of Things (IoT), disaster response, and fraud detection. - Experience creating, organizing, and managing project-based interdisciplinary training programs at universities on AI for social impact. Elena is particularly passionate about solving challenging problems with a social impact, and is currently serving Research Director at Stanford’s RegLab. In the summer of 2013 Elena co-founded the Data Science for Social Good (DSSG) program at the University of Chicago, a project-based fellowship for aspiring data scientists from around the world to work on high-impact projects for nonprofits and government agencies globally. She later returned to lead the program and now serves on its board of directors. Additionally, Elena helped establish and directed the DataLab program, a similar DSSG-style fellowship for top U.S.-based undergraduates, held at Sewanee, the University of the South. A longtime Bay Area resident, Elena balances her love of “sciencing with data” with volunteering for local organizations, mentoring young people in tech, social dancing, and tending to her succulents.
